On Wed, Nov 13, 2024 at 12:39:01PM +0100, Jacopo Mondi wrote:
> Hi Laurent
> 
> On Tue, Nov 12, 2024 at 08:56:37PM +0200, Laurent Pinchart wrote:
> > std::from_chars(), introduced in C++17, is a fast, locale-independent
> > string-to-arithmetic conversion function. The C++ standard library
> > provides overloads for all integer types, making it a prime candidate to
> > replace the manual handling of integer sizes in the YamlParser string to
> > integer conversion.
> >
> > Compared to std::strtol(), std::from_chars() doesn't recognize the '0x'
> 
> only if the base is 16, or do I read
> https://en.cppreference.com/w/cpp/utility/from_chars
> wrong

You're correct. If the base is 10, there should be no '0x' prefix
anyway.

> > prefix or '+' prefix, and doesn't ignore leading white space. As the
> > YamlParser doesn't require those features, std::from_chars() can be used
> > safely, reducing the amount of code.
> 
> Ok, I presume we won't have "0x.." entries in config files ?

I wouldn't assume so, as we explicitly specify base 10 in the strtol()
call.

> > C++17 also requires the standard C++ library to provide overloads for
> > floating-point types, but libc++ does not implement those. The float and
> 
> Do you know why ?

I believe it's more complicated than it may seem. The C++ standard
requires that the roundtrip std::from_chars(std::to_chars(value))
produces the exact same value, and apparently it's not trivial.

> > bool implementations of YamlParser::Getter::get() are therefore kept
> > as-is.
